Tuesday, March 4, 2025 – Luncheon & Presentation on Name, Image & Likeness with Greg Dooley
The Club at Olde Cypress
7165 Treeline Drive, Naples, Florida

Registration is now available for the U-M Alumni Club of SW Florida’s upcoming event on Tuesday March 4th, 2025 at The Club at Olde Cypress. We are most fortunate to have Professor Greg Dooley from the University of Michigan speaking to us, at our luncheon, on the very hot topic of Name, Image & Likeness (NIL) in college sports. Professor Dooley is a college football historian at the University of Michigan, where he teaches three popular courses on athletics history, sports leadership, and NIL (Name, Image & Likeness). He shares fascinating stories of mysteries and scandals from the primordial days of U-M and B1G Football. While we may be experiencing a wild time in college athletics, Dooley suggests “the more things change, the more they stay the same.” He has appeared on documentaries and features on The Big Ten Network, and The New York Times, and he is the co-host of the ‘Professor and The Pundit’ podcast. He’ll also share insights on the current events inside Schembechler Hall on NIL, revenue-sharing and much more. Our club president attended a luncheon given by Greg in Petoskey, Michigan last summer and is confident you’ll enjoy his presentation.
